About Square One

Artist and Song: Tom Petty - Square One
Album: Elizabethtown
Genre: Pop, Pop Rock, Rock
Year: 2005
Difficulty: Moderate
Tuning: G C E A
Key: C
Chords: [C], [Am], [G], [F], [E], [A], [D], [B]
Strumming: D - DU - DU - DU
